  • Publication number: 20230398534
    Abstract: The present invention relates to a diagnostic cartridge, which may comprise: a housing that has formed therein a receiving space, and has formed, on the upper surface thereof, a first inlet and a second inlet that are spaced apart from each other in communication with the receiving space and an outer space; and a solution supply device that is integrally or detachably mounted in the second inlet, receives a washing solution and a reaction solution, and sequentially introduces at intervals the washing solution and the reaction solution into a membrane pad through the second inlet.

  • Publication number: 20230342133
    Abstract: Disclosed herein are an apparatus and method for generating a neural network executable image. The apparatus includes one or more processors and executable memory for storing at least one program executed by the one or more processors. The at least one program receives user requirements including a default neural network model and training result data for generating a neural network executable image required by a user, checks whether the default neural network model included in the user requirements is capable of being supported in a target system in which the neural network executable image is to be installed, converts the default neural network model into a neural network model executable in the target system, converts the training result data by reconfiguring the data format set of the training result data, and generates a neural network executable image by combining the converted neural network model and the converted training result data.

  • Publication number: 20230315402
    Abstract: Disclosed herein are an apparatus and method for developing a neural network application. The apparatus includes one or more processors and executable memory for storing at least one program executed by the one or more processors. The at least one program receives a target specification and an application specification including user requirements, searches for a neural network model corresponding to the target specification and the application specification in a database, builds an inference engine for performing a neural network operation used by the neural network model, and generates a target image for executing the neural network model to be suitable for a target device using the inference engine.
